> Is there a why to tell how many jsessionid's is valid in my webapp.

Not sure what you mean by "valid" here; would "active" be a better term?

> I want to use it to display the number of online users?

Create an HttpSessionListener (see section 10 of the servlet spec), and have it keep track of who's logging in and out.
